Abstract

1,221,005. Vehicle spring suspensions. VAUXHALL MOTORS Ltd. 2 Oct., 1969 [15 Nov., 1968], No. 54377/68. Heading B7D. In a vehicle beam axle suspension system, a U-shaped suspension member 10 is disposed with its arms 12, 14 directed rearwardly and is pivotally connected, in the central region of its base 16, to a vehicle body portion, the member 10 supporting an axle 22 and having a transverse leaf spring 44 flexibly supported by the ends of its arms, the vehicle body portion being mounted on the leaf spring by means of a pair of spaced mounts 50, 52. The pivotal connection 18 of the member 10 to the vehicle body comprises brackets 68, 70 fixed to the member 10 and pivoted to a transverse rod (62) (Fig. 2, not shown), which is flexibly supported by brackets 20 on the body portion. The rod (62) may pass beneath the vehicle propeller shaft 38, being appropriately bent centrally for this purpose. The member 10 may additionally be connected to a differential housing, and also the vehicle body by means of Panhard rod 58. The latter may, alternatively, be connected to the axle and body. Vibration dampers 74, 76 may be provided between the body and the axle or, as shown, the ends 40, 42 of the arms of member 10. These ends 40, 42 may be splayed outwardly to enhance roll-resistance of leaf spring 44. Some, or all, of the suspension-to-body connections may comprise elastomeric members. Specifically, the pivotal connection 18 comprises elastomeric bushes (64, 66), the ends of the leaf spring are supported by elastomeric blocks 46, 48, and the mounts 50, 52 comprise elastomeric pads.
